[Dispatch=Reporter Lee Myung-ju] SEVENTEEN proved their popularity in Japan.
The Japan Record Association announced Gold Disk certification works on the 10th (June). They received "Million" certification with their 11th mini album 'Seventeen's Heaven.'
"Million" is one of nine certification standards set by the Japan Record Association. Albums with cumulative shipments of over 1 million copies receive Gold Disk certification.
It is the only foreign artist album to receive "Million" certification this year. 'Seventeen's Heaven' has maintained steady popularity since its release in October 2023.
The album also set a new K-pop record for the most first-week sales (sales during the first week of album release). In the first week of its release, it sold over 5.09 million copies.
SEVENTEEN has now obtained their third Gold Disk "Million" certification. They had previously set records with their first Japanese EP 'Dream' and their 10th mini album 'FML.'
They said, "We are happy to receive this surprising news. We are grateful to CARAT (fandom name)," and added, "We will show you various activities, so we ask for your support."
Meanwhile, SEVENTEEN is continuing unit and solo activities. 'V8' will hold a solo concert on the 11th. Dino will release a solo album as 'alternate character' Picheorin.
